IFF Brugge, still known in the region as “the yeast factory”, produces enzymes that are used in beer, bread, animal feed, biofuels, têxtiles and detergents, among other things.

The development and production of enzymes is a high-tech and complex process. Over the years, IFF Brugge has developed specific knowledge and expertise in biotechnology.
